Just an update on our bus experience at AKL Jambo. From Jambo to the parks the buses have be on time. We have not missed a bus due to it picking up at Kidani first. Our longest wait for a bus was about 10 min. From the parks has been fine too.Seems to be a bus every 15-20 min.
I was concerned about this when I booked, so glad we didn't shy away from AKL because of buses. It's been a great stay so far.
